The City:
"Williamsburg is a city in and the county seat of Whitley County, Kentucky, United States. The population was 5,143 at the 2000 census. The city was founded in 1818 and named after William Whitley" - from Wikipedia:

The flag of the City of Williamsburg, Kentucky, is a vertical one, and has a city seal on an ochre background. The seal shows a building (a city hall?) in black on an orange circle. Around are words "CITY OF WILLIAMSBURG / KENTUCKY" and "FEELS LIKE HOME" over the seal. Photo of the flag thanks to Teresa Black, City Clerk.
